Price for Sulphides of Non-Metals; Commercial Phosphorus Trisulphide in the Czech Republic (CIF) - 2022

In 2022, the average import price for sulphides of non-metals; commercial phosphorus trisulphides amounted to $879 per ton, flattening at the previous year. In general, the import price showed moderate growth.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2016 an increase of 336% against the previous year. The import price peaked in 2022 and is expected to retain growth in the immediate term.

There were significant differences in the average prices amongst the major supplying countries. In 2022, amid the top importers, the country with the highest price was Russia ($18,832 per ton), while the price for Germany ($553 per ton) was amongst the lowest.

From 2012 to 2022,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was attained by Russia (+74.8%), while the prices for the other major suppliers experienced more modest paces of growth.

Price for Sulphides of Non-Metals; Commercial Phosphorus Trisulphide in the Czech Republic (FOB) - 2022

In 2022, the average export price for sulphides of non-metals; commercial phosphorus trisulphides amounted to $58,667 per ton, remaining constant against the previous year. Over the period under review, the export price, however, recorded a relatively flat trend pattern. The growth pace was the most rapid in 2021 an increase of 1,488% against the previous year. As a result, the export price reached the peak level of $59,091 per ton, leveling off in the following year.

Prices varied noticeably by country of destination: amid the top suppliers, the country with the highest price was Slovakia ($69,000 per ton), while the average price for exports to Germany ($8,000 per ton) was amongst the lowest.

From 2012 to 2022,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was recorded for supplies to Serbia (+325.0%), while the prices for the other major destinations experienced more modest paces of growth.

Imports of Sulphides of Non-Metals; Commercial Phosphorus Trisulphide in the Czech Republic

Imports of sulphides of non-metals; commercial phosphorus trisulphides into the Czech Republic shrank to 2.2K tons in 2022, falling by -14.7% compared with the year before. Over the period under review, imports saw a abrupt shrinkage. The pace of growth appeared the most rapid in 2021 when imports increased by 18%.

In value terms, imports of sulphides of non-metals; commercial phosphorus trisulphides shrank to $2M in 2022. Overall, imports continue to indicate a relatively flat trend pattern. The pace of growth appeared the most rapid in 2021 with an increase of 56% against the previous year. As a result, imports reached the peak of $2.3M, and then shrank in the following year.

Exports of Sulphides of Non-Metals; Commercial Phosphorus Trisulphide in the Czech Republic

In 2022, approx. 6 kg of sulphides of non-metals; commercial phosphorus trisulphides were exported from the Czech Republic; which is down by -72.7% compared with 2021. Over the period under review, exports continue to indicate a significant curtailment. The smallest decline of -52.7% was in 2020.

In value terms, exports of sulphides of non-metals; commercial phosphorus trisulphides dropped notably to $352 in 2022. In general, exports continue to indicate a precipitous contraction. The pace of growth appeared the most rapid in 2021 when exports increased by 236%.
